Abstract
The rare earth element (REE) concentrations in
the Bay of Brunei were measured in the riverine, main bay area and the South
China Sea. The abundance of REE in dissolved, particulate and sediment
decreased from light REE (LREE) > medium REE (MREE) > heavy REE (HREE).
The ΣREE concentrations were higher in January 2014 as compared to July
2013 in river and estuary sampling sites in all matrices, but more so in the
particulate fraction. LREE was found to be highly enriched over HREE in
sediment with La/Yb of 22.3 in July 2013 and 14.9 in January 2014. LREE
enrichment occurred to a lesser degree in particulate fraction in seawater with
La/Yb in the range of 11.7 to 12.8 in July 2013 and 8.4 to 10.6 in January
2014. In the dissolved fraction, LREE was enriched in July 2013 with La/Yb of
3.3 – 3.5 but in January 2014, during the wet Northeast Monsoon season, LREE
was depleted with La/Yb of 0.48 in bottom water and 0.74 in surface water.
Enhanced scavenging by the higher SPM content entering the bay during the wet season
is thought to be the cause of the removal of LREE from the dissolved fraction.
